Wearable and Mobile Tech: What it Means for Nonprofits - #15NTCwearable

From Google Glass, to Health Monitoring devices and fitness app, and to the iBeacon, new technologies are putting a world of data and possibilities in front of nonprofits. Together we’ll go through some of the implications of these new devices and apps, and how nonprofits can effectively utilize them.

We’ll discuss their uses for advocacy, costs, the privacy concerns they can raise, and how to make good decisions about investing resources into them and putting them to use for your organization.
